Constanța, Romania
Romania's largest seaport and one of the most important ports on the Black Sea. Constanța offers modern facilities with sufficient water depths to accommodate large vessels passing through the Suez Canal. The port features direct access to the Danube-Black Sea Canal, extensive storage facilities, and comprehensive cargo handling capabilities.

Mangalia, Southern Romania
Located close to the Bulgarian border, approximately 260km north of Istanbul. Mangalia serves as both a commercial port and fishing harbor, featuring shipyard facilities for vessel repair and maintenance. The port's strategic location makes it ideal for regional cargo operations and maritime services.
Danube Delta, Eastern Romania
Free port located at the mouth of the Sulina branch of the Danube River, serving as the gateway between the Danube River and the Black Sea. Sulina provides crucial river-sea transshipment services and connects to all European inland waterways via the Danube. The 40-mile Sulina Channel serves as a vital grain export route.
Samsun, Turkey
Turkey's largest port in the Black Sea region and the only Black Sea port with railway connection. Samsun features modern container terminals, extensive storage facilities (356,530 sqm open area + 12,019 sqm covered), and serves a large hinterland covering Central Anatolia. The port handles containers, bulk cargo, and general cargo with excellent infrastructure.
Trabzon, Eastern Turkey
Important eastern Black Sea port serving as a gateway to Eastern Turkey and the Caucasus region. Trabzon provides 24-hour pilotage and tugboat services, modern container facilities, and comprehensive cargo handling operations. The port serves as a crucial transit route to Georgia, Armenia, and Azerbaijan.
